Cannot install IE6 Service Pack1 on Windows ME

I downloaded the ie6setup.exe into c:\WINDOWS\Windows Update Setup Files. When I run the setup, I get the EULA and accept, click NEXT, choose Minimal so I can just install what I want, and then I get an error message saying that not all the components were installed. :whistling: Those components meaning the WHOLE package... :blink: and sometimes even a message saying to shut off all other running applications. There's nothing running in the background! The only thing running is Explorer, Systray, and the installation for IE6, and for some reason it won't install the pack.
